首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

具有每个子句上的参数的联合的SQL视图

是一种数据库概念。它是通过将一个或多个查询结果合并成一个虚拟的表来创建的。这样可以简化复杂的查询操作,并且提高查询性能。

SQL视图是基于一个或多个表的查询结果创建的,它不存储实际的数据,而是作为一个逻辑表存在。可以对视图进行增删改查等操作,就像对实际的表一样。

联合的SQL视图是指在创建视图时,使用了参数来过滤结果集。这样可以根据不同的参数值获取不同的查询结果。

优势:

  1. 数据安全性:通过视图可以限制用户对数据的访问权限,只暴露必要的数据给用户,提高数据安全性。
  2. 简化复杂查询:通过创建视图,可以将复杂的查询操作封装起来,简化查询语句,提高开发效率。
  3. 提高性能:视图可以预先计算查询结果,并将结果缓存起来,减少重复查询的开销,提高查询性能。
  4. 数据一致性:通过视图可以保证数据的一致性,当多个表之间存在关联关系时,通过视图可以将这些关联关系映射出来,确保数据的完整性。

应用场景:

  1. 复杂查询:当需要进行多表关联查询或者包含多个子查询的查询时,可以使用视图来简化查询语句。
  2. 数据权限管理:通过视图可以控制用户对数据的访问权限,实现数据的安全性管理。
  3. 报表生成:可以使用视图来生成报表,将复杂的查询结果转化为易读的报表格式。

腾讯云相关产品: 腾讯云提供了云数据库 TencentDB,其中包括云数据库SQL Server、云数据库MySQL等,这些数据库服务可以用于创建和管理SQL视图。您可以通过以下链接了解更多关于腾讯云数据库的信息:

注意:这里只提供了腾讯云作为一个示例,您也可以根据具体情况使用其他云计算服务提供商的相关产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券